Blade of Wordsrokudenashi

A moving piece by the band Rokudenashi.

Released as a digital single in January 2025, it’s also included on the mini-album Sigh, announced in February.

The sound is rooted in traditional Japanese instruments, blending ethereal beauty with a contemporary sensibility.

The vocalist, Ninjin, delivers a whispery tone that suits the song perfectly.

The lyrics grapple with the difficulties of living in modern society, making it a song that speaks to those searching for their true selves.

threadNakajima Miyuki

A classic song that likens encounters with loved ones and the workings of fate to the warp and weft used in silk weaving.

The irreplaceable bonds formed with those we meet eventually become a beautiful fabric that warmly envelops someone—this is the wonderful tale woven by Miyuki Nakajima in this gem of a track.

Its emotionally rich melody and lyrics that pierce the heart are in perfect harmony, gently embracing the listener.

Released in October 1992 on the album “EAST ASIA,” it returned to the spotlight in 1998 as the theme song for the drama “Seija no Kōshin” (March of the Saints).

Sparked by a cover by Bank Band, it has continued to be cherished as a wedding staple.

In a new cityImai Miki

A signature song by Miki Imai, woven with warm words and a gentle melody that stays close during life’s turning points.

It’s a gem-like ballad that closes her August 1990 album “retour.” The calmly flowing melody and Imai’s clear, transparent vocals softly depict the resolve and hope needed to live in a new environment.

YokazeHentai Shinshi Kurabu

This is a song whose wistful vocals over a lo-fi beat really sink into your heart.

You can picture yourself in a car speeding down the highway at night, letting the wind rush in through the window as you try to blow away your daily worries and anxieties.

The balance between rap and singing by Hentai Shinshi Club is exquisite, crafting a story-like world with a mellow vibe.

Released in April 2020, it was included on the album “HERO” the same year, and it was also used as the walk-up music for Rakuten Eagles player Hideto Asamura.

Stop that nightTeranishi Yūma

This is a song by Yuma Teranishi that portrays the ache of unrequited love.

It’s a ballad that reflects on a special night now past, resonating with regret over a lost love and a wish to reunite.

Released as a digital single in November 2024, it was selected as the theme song for the BS Fuji drama “Kazuhiro Teranishi Mystery: SPELL: Revenge of the Green Monkey.” Teranishi himself wrote, composed, and arranged the piece, infusing it with a message that respects diverse forms of love.

bandageOkazaki Miho

A song that gently stays close to your emotional scars—like a musical bandage.

It’s a track by Miho Okasaki, who is also active as a voice actor, released in December 2024.

The lyrics and composition are by the popular Vocaloid producer 40mP.

Time that has passed won’t come back, but even so, we’ll face forward and start walking… The strong, purposeful message embedded in the lyrics gives you courage.

Fantasy in the CornerHirai Dai

It’s a heartwarming love song.

This track is the title song of the EP “Fantasy in the Corner,” released in November 2024.

It’s the seventh installment of the consecutive EP release project “LUCKY BAG.” Perfect for winter, the lyrics—filled with feelings for a loved one—leave a strong impression.

You can feel the desire to cherish the small happiness found in everyday life.

Dai Hirai’s gentle voice also resonates in a way that feels close to the listener’s heart.
